  • CBOT: Mini-sized Dow Options Gaining Interest

    Date 30/08/2004

    CBOT® mini-sized DowSM options (OYM) are garnering interest from proprietary trading firms and institutional investors as a more efficient DowSM derivative than the DJX or DIA options. Launched February, 2004, an electronic market-maker program and request-for-quote (RFQ) functionality are two crucial reasons for the increasing interest in trading Dow options.

  • NYSE Seat Sells For $1,150,000

    Date 27/08/2004

    A regular seat sold on the New York Stock Exchange on Friday, August 27, 2004 for $1,150,000; down $100,000 from the previous regular seat sale on August 17, 2004.

  • Nymex To Add Six-Month Differential To Calendar Spread Options Contracts

    Date 27/08/2004

    The New York Mercantile Exchange, Inc., announced that beginning on Monday it will list an additional crude oil calendar spread options contract based on a six–month differential.
